diff --git a/CMakeLists.txt b/CMakeLists.txt
index 754f069b..19ee2a86 100644
--- a/CMakeLists.txt
+++ b/CMakeLists.txt
@@ -232,9 +232,34 @@ endif (IOS)
 
 unset(CERES_COMPILE_OPTIONS)
 
+# We call find_package multiple time with different versioning scheme to support
+# both Eigen3 3.x and 5.x. If the first invocation fails and Eigen3_DIR was set
+# to a possible location, e.g., during cross-compilation, failure to locate the
+# package will unset the variable. To avoid losing the path hint, we save it and
+# reuse it in the second find_package call.
+set (_Ceres_Eigen3_DIR)
+
+if (Eigen3_DIR)
+  set (_Ceres_Eigen3_DIR "${Eigen3_DIR}")
+endif (Eigen3_DIR)
+
 # Eigen.
 # Eigen delivers Eigen3Config.cmake since v3.3.3
-find_package(Eigen3 3.3.4 REQUIRED NO_MODULE)
+find_package(Eigen3 3.3.4...5 NO_MODULE)
+
+if (NOT Eigen3_FOUND)
+  if (_Ceres_Eigen3_DIR)
+    set (Eigen3_DIR "${_Ceres_Eigen3_DIR}")
+  endif (_Ceres_Eigen3_DIR)
+  # Eigen3's CMake package config prior to 5.0.0 does not support version ranges
+  # with different major version components. To ensure backward compatibility,
+  # we locate the package using the previous version scheme as a fallback
+  # mechanism.
+  find_package(Eigen3 3.3.4 REQUIRED NO_MODULE)
+endif (NOT Eigen3_FOUND)
+
+unset (_Ceres_Eigen3_DIR)
+
 if (Eigen3_FOUND)
   message("-- Found Eigen version ${Eigen3_VERSION}: ${Eigen3_DIR}")
